Catholic Singles

Single, separated, widowed or divorced?

Catholic Singles is an organisation which aims to help practising Catholics meet other Catholics and support Catholic Parishes and Charities. It does this by providing an optional, strictly confidential service, sending members a monthly bulletin, which includes brief personal descriptions of themselves, if they wish, and also advertising social events organised by Catholic parishes and organisations free of charge.

We advertise in The Universe, The Catholic Times and The Catholic Herald, in most diocesan newspapers, and in parishes around the country and are non profit-making, with the £10 annual membership fee and initial donation going towards operating costs. All members receive our monthly bulletin called Catholic Networking. The membership itself is growing daily, and we are now the biggest Catholic singles group of its kind in the country, as far as we know. We organise social events, as well as providing a facility which allows members to meet on a one-to-one basis if they wish.

Theology Discussion Group

A theology discussion group has been continuing since September. The idea is that participants take it in turns to prepare a short question of a theological or philosophical nature for discussion by the group. It is usually held at 7:00pm in St. Edwards Hall. Loreto High School, Chorlton

St Thomas Aquinas was totally re-structured and has many new staff and new roles and way of teaching and was re-named Loreto High School, associating with the prestigious name of the Loreto Sisters who have run schools all over the world for 150 years. The Loreto Mother General has approved of this use of their name.
